Title:
  ettercap produces Error 11 and runs out of resources

Status in “ettercap” package in Ubuntu:
  Fix Released

Bug description:
  OS: Ubuntu 10.04 2GB RAM 2 Processors (Is patched with the latest
  updated from the repos)

  Issue:
  I was poisoning 22 victims, ettercap lasted roughly 10 minutes before it 
closed with the following message:
  ERROR : 11, Resource temporarily unavailable
  [ec_threads.c:ec_thread_new:203]

   not enough resources to create a new thread in this process

  I found this in my research, apparently its from the Ettercap forums/bug list 
from 2004:
  "It's a known issue because pthread_exit seems to not free correctly threads' 
memory. 
  We are investigating this problem."

  My etter.conf has the ec_uid & gid set to 0 and the proper iptables
  redirs uncommented.

  I have experienced this issue with ettercap installs from both the
  Ubuntu repos & compiling from source.

  ulimit is set to unlimited:
  root@blank:~# ulimit -Ha
  core file size          (blocks, -c) unlimited
  data seg size           (kbytes, -d) unlimited
  scheduling priority             (-e) 20
  file size               (blocks, -f) unlimited
  pending signals                 (-i) 16382
  max locked memory       (kbytes, -l) 64
  max memory size         (kbytes, -m) unlimited
  open files                      (-n) 1024
  pipe size            (512 bytes, -p) 8
  POSIX message queues     (bytes, -q) 819200
  real-time priority              (-r) 0
  stack size              (kbytes, -s) unlimited
  cpu time               (seconds, -t) unlimited
  max user processes              (-u) unlimited
  virtual memory          (kbytes, -v) unlimited
  file locks                      (-x) unlimited

  As a workaround I set my max threads to 123,456,789 up from 39K. It
  still ran out of resources after about 15 minutes.

  I am not a developer, but in reading up on pthreads, it looks like you
  have to specify "joinable" if you use pthread_join and the code does
  not appear to do this. However, I know nothing about pthreads and am
  still learning the basics of C.
